Output d8ae508c280cb2f691a6721c16b34bc9d1cbb8f9c9d194e67b3ef884bc30b482:2

value
85676086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d9413e7e5e5a8b1b18a20ef66141e6eff61074 OP_EQUAL
address
MBFzpU7t69ESYdi2sManTmZtvgRCANFGxy
transaction
d8ae508c280cb2f691a6721c16b34bc9d1cbb8f9c9d194e67b3ef884bc30b482
spent
true